Aspathrekaval
Aspathrekaval is a village in the southern state of Karnataka, India.[1][2] It is located in the Hunsur taluk of Mysore district.

DemographicsEdit
As of 2001[update] India census, Aspathrekaval had a population of 5090 with 2561 males and 2529 females.[1]
